Output d687583b3faa30abc35f40346149fec1eda20452feb4b5ea84c77f55e5933f34:3

value
657599
script pubkey
OP_0 OP_PUSHBYTES_20 e365f1fdce61824dbfe0648babd59e1780157874
address
bc1qudjlrlwwvxpym0lqvj96h4v7z7qp27r539dlm4
transaction
d687583b3faa30abc35f40346149fec1eda20452feb4b5ea84c77f55e5933f34
spent
true